Understanding the Threat of Termites in Dubai

Dubai’s climate, featuring warm temperatures and seasonal humidity, presents favorable conditions for termite activity. Subterranean termites are the predominant species posing risks to buildings in Dubai, including Al Khawaneej 1.

Left untreated, termite infestations can undermine foundations, wooden structures, and even damage electrical wiring, resulting in expensive repairs and compromised safety.

Recognizing early signs such as mud tubes, hollow wood, and discarded wings can be challenging without expert assistance. Hence, professional inspection and tailored termite proofing methods Al Khawaneej 1 are recommended to prevent infestations.

Top 5 Termite Proofing Methods Al Khawaneej 1

When it comes to termite proofing methods Al Khawaneej 1 residents prefer, there are several proven approaches. Employing a combination of these methods can significantly enhance effectiveness.

1. Soil Treatment with Termiticide Barriers

Applying chemical termiticides to the soil surrounding buildings creates an invisible barrier that repels or kills termites before they access the structure. This is one of the most common and reliable termite proofing methods Al Khawaneej 1 experts recommend.

2. Physical Barriers Using Stainless Steel Mesh

Incorporating stainless steel mesh during construction around foundations and entry points prevents termite penetration. This eco-friendly option is increasingly popular for new or renovated properties.

3. Wood Treatment with Borate Solutions

Treating wood used inside homes or offices with borate-based products strengthens resistance against termite attack. These treatments penetrate the wood and remain effective over time while being safe for indoor environments.

4. Baiting Systems for Active Infestations

Using termite bait stations around affected properties allows gradual elimination of termite colonies. This method is particularly useful for managing existing termite problems discreetly and sustainably.

5. Regular Inspection and Maintenance

Scheduling routine inspections ensures early detection and timely interventions. Combining inspections with moisture control, landscaping adjustments, and sealing entry points forms a comprehensive termite proofing strategy Al Khawaneej 1 properties benefit from.

Method Benefits Application
Soil Treatment Long-lasting chemical barrier Applied by professionals around foundations
Physical Barrier Non-toxic, effective for new builds Installed during construction phases
Wood Treatment Protects wood internally Applied before or after installation of wood materials
Baiting System Targets colonies directly Station placement around property perimeter
Regular Inspection Early detection, prevention Scheduled visits from certified pest control providers

Practical Tips for Long-Term Termite Prevention in Al Khawaneej 1

  • Eliminate moisture sources near foundations by fixing leaks and ensuring proper drainage.
  • Keep wooden elements, fences, and landscaping materials away from direct soil contact.
  • Store firewood and debris away from residential buildings to discourage termite nesting.
  • Seal cracks and joints in the building perimeter to block termite entry points.
  • Schedule annual professional termite inspections with trusted local providers.

Subterranean Barrier Systems: The Foundation of Termite Defense

One of the most effective termite proofing methods Al Khawaneej 1 involves creating a chemical barrier beneath and around the foundation of new or existing buildings. These subterranean termite barriers are applied during the construction phase or as a retrofit treatment option. They use termiticides approved by Dubai Municipality and ESMA (Emirates Authority for Standardization and Metrology), which are environmentally compliant products ensuring safety and effectiveness.

Installation typically involves treating the soil under slab foundations, around footings, and void areas. The barrier disrupts termite foraging behavior by acting as a treated zone termites cannot bypass. This method also minimizes the risk of contamination to the surrounding soil and groundwater, aligning with Dubai’s environmental regulations.

  • Pre-construction soil treatment: Applying termiticides during initial site preparation creates an initial shield against termite entry.
  • Post-construction soil treatment: Used where termite activity is detected or suspected, ensuring the barrier remains intact despite prior construction.
  • Monitoring and maintenance: Regular inspections ensure the barrier’s integrity and identify any breaches for timely retreatment.

Professional termite contractors in Al Khawaneej 1 adopt precise application techniques, calibrating chemical concentration and depth according to Dubai Municipality’s pest control requirements. This guarantees the barrier is robust without overuse of chemicals, protecting property investments sustainably.

Physical Barriers and Building Design Adjustments

While chemical barriers handle existing soil conditions, physical termite barriers and design considerations provide a non-chemical preventive dimension increasingly favored in Dubai, especially in environmentally sensitive developments such as Arabian Ranches and Nad Al Sheba.

These physical systems are often installed during construction to prevent termite access to vulnerable wooden structures or flooring. Some common physical termite proofing methods Al Khawaneej 1 homeowners utilize include:

  • Stainless steel mesh barriers: Installed beneath slabs or around pipes and service penetrations, these meshes prevent termites from tunneling through structural gaps.
  • Concrete or metal shields: Placed around foundational elements to block termite ingress paths.
  • Non-cellulose building materials: Using termite-resistant materials such as treated concrete, steel frames, and composite wood products minimizes the risk of infestation.

Beyond materials, architectural design can assist termite proofing. Creating accessible inspection points, ensuring proper drainage, and avoiding wood-to-soil contact are critical in areas like Al Khawaneej 1 where landscaping and irrigation systems may inadvertently encourage termite activity.

Integrated Pest Management (IPM): Long-Term Termite Control Strategy

Recognizing that no single method guarantees complete termite elimination, especially in termite-prone zones like Al Khawaneej 1, many property owners employ Integrated Pest Management (IPM). This approach combines chemical, physical, and biological control methods tailored to the site’s unique conditions. IPM aligns with Dubai Municipality’s push for sustainable pest control practices that safeguard human health and the environment.

Key IPM components include:

  • Regular inspections: Scheduled professional checks detect early termite activity before damage occurs.
  • Soil and moisture management: Reducing excess moisture near building foundations through proper landscaping and drainage limits termite attraction.
  • Use of biological agents: Incorporating termite predators or microbial pesticides approved in Dubai adds a layer of ecological termite suppression.
  • Targeted chemical treatments: Applying termiticides precisely limits chemical usage and potential resistance development among termite colonies.

Maintenance and Post-Treatment Care as Part of Termite Proofing

Termite proofing methods Al Khawaneej 1 do not end with a single treatment phase. Due to the persistent nature of termites and environmental influences, ongoing maintenance is critical. Pest control companies recommend routine inspections every six to twelve months, alongside spot treatments as needed. This vigilance ensures that termite colonies are detected early and controlled before they damage structural integrity.

Some practical tips for homeowners and facilities managers include:

  • Ensuring garden irrigation systems do not cause waterlogging near foundations.
  • Removing wood debris and firewood from close proximity to buildings.
  • Avoiding direct soil-to-wood contact for patios, decks, or wooden fences.
  • Checking for mud tubes on walls and foundations—classic tunnel indicators.

Dubai’s hot climate means termite activity can continue year-round, though humidity fluctuations influence behavior patterns. An effective termite proofing strategy therefore incorporates seasonally adapted inspection routines to maximize preventative impact.
